2. The Importance of Understanding Pregnancy-Specific Concerns

Pregnancy comes with unique physical and emotional challenges that require special attention in yoga classes.

Backaches, swelling, and fatigue are common issues that a skilled yoga teacher can address through appropriate poses and techniques.

A good teacher will know how to adjust routines to avoid adding strain to the joints and muscles.

They will also focus on poses that improve circulation and reduce tension in areas like the lower back and hips.

Understanding these specific concerns shows that the teacher prioritizes your comfort and well-being.

7. Ensuring Safety in Prenatal Yoga: What a Good Teacher Should Prioritize

Safety in prenatal yoga means avoiding poses or techniques that could strain your body or harm your baby.

A qualified teacher will steer clear of deep twists, backbends, or poses requiring lying flat on your back after the first trimester.

They will guide you in using props to maintain balance and prevent overextension.

Attention to proper alignment in every pose reduces the risk of discomfort or injury.

Teachers who emphasize safety help you practice with confidence and peace of mind.

9. A Holistic Approach: The Role of Breathing and Relaxation in Prenatal Yoga

Breathing and relaxation are central to a successful prenatal yoga practice.

Controlled breathing techniques, such as diaphragmatic breathing, help calm your mind and prepare you for labor.

Relaxation exercises, including guided meditations, promote better sleep and stress relief.

A skilled teacher will incorporate these elements into every class to enhance physical and emotional balance.

Focusing on these practices builds resilience and equips you with tools to handle labor and parenthood.
